Hankel determinants and Jacobi continued fractions for $q$-Euler numbers
The $q$-analogs of Bernoulli and Euler numbers were introduced by Carlitz in 1948. Similar to recent results on the Hankel determinants for the $q$-Bernoulli numbers established by Chapoton and Zeng, we perform a parallel analysis for the $q$-Euler numbers.
